Ed Doheny
Born: 11/24/1873 in Northfield, VT, USA
Died: 12/29/1916 in Medfield, MA, USA
MLB Debut: 1895-09-16 | Final Game: 1903-09-07
Bats: L | Throws: L | Height: 5'10" | Weight: 165 lbs
Full name: Edward Richard Doheny
Biography
Ed Doheny, born in 1873, was a professional baseball pitcher who played in Major League Baseball from 1895 to 1903. Over the course of his career, he appeared in games for several teams, establishing himself as a reliable arm in the late 19th century and early 20th century, a transitional period in baseball where the game was beginning to evolve away from the deadball era. Doheny finished his career with a record of 75 wins and 83 losses, showcasing his tenacity on the mound despite facing stiff competition.
Doheny recorded an earned run average (ERA) of 3.73 and struck out 572 batters, reflecting his ability to generate swings and misses during an era when pitchers often relied on finesse and control rather than overpowering velocity. He also contributed to his teams with two saves, highlighting his capability in critical game situations.
